Subject: RE: Edible beans



NE ND
For the most part, terrible again for the 5th year in a row. Replanted 250 acres out of 1650 from drown out, and drown out the replants again on Wednesday & Friday. Not a single field where I'm at that's good from corner to corner. We'll have beans starting to flower anywhere from 2 weeks to 6 weeks and anywhere in-between. Can't get in to spray because its too wet and everything is growing fast with this heat. Dry down and harvest will be a complete nightmare and most likely stretch deep into October or November again. It's getting hard to want to keep growing these things with the weather we've been dealt over the last decade, especially the last 5.
